2022 Porsche 718 Cayman Gt4 — MOT failures & pass rate
301 MOT tests on the 2022 Porsche 718 Cayman Gt4 are in this dataset, and 95.7% of them passed. Against all cars of a similar age (8.1% fail rate), the 2022 718 Cayman Gt4 comes out 3.8pp better. Failures cluster in other defects, tyres and lighting & signalling.
What the MOT record shows
No single area dominates — other defects (1.7%) and tyres (1.7%) are close, so failures are spread across several systems rather than one weak point.
At component level the recurring items are registration plates, headlamp cleaning device and windscreen — registration plates alone was recorded 5 times.

What to check before buying a 2022 718 Cayman Gt4
The failure pattern for this year is specific enough to inspect against: other defects accounted for 1.7% of tests. Start there.
- Other defects (1.7% of tests): Miscellaneous items not in the main categories. Typical repair: varies.
- Tyres (1.7% of tests): Usually a quick, known-cost fix, but check tread, age and uneven wear (which can hint at alignment or suspension issues). Typical repair: £50–£120 per tyre.
- Lighting & signalling (1.0% of tests): Often a cheap bulb, but persistent issues can mean wiring or corrosion in the units. Typical repair: £10–£150.
Repair costs are rough UK ballpark ranges to set expectations, not quotes — actual prices vary widely by car, parts and garage.
